Latest Patents
One of her latest patents is the Channel Cut Polishing Machine. This device is designed for polishing multi-surface workpieces. It features a base and a vertical motion platform that moves along two support rods. The platform carries a motor that drives a rotating shaft, with the support rods extending from the base. A polishing tool is attached to the motor shaft, and the workpiece being polished is placed on a linear motion stage during the polishing process.
